การติดตั้ง Autoprt บน DOS

การติดตั้ง Autoprt บน DOS

โพสต์โดย Nongyai เมื่อ จันทร์ พ.ย. 10, 2008 10:58 am

เกิดปัญหาคือ เครื่องปริ้นพอร์ต Serial ไม่ทำงาน แจ้ง Error "เครื่องพิมพ์ใบสั่งยาไม่พร้อม....กรุณาตรวจสอบ"[/b]
Nongyai
 
โพสต์: 5
ลงทะเบียนเมื่อ: อังคาร พ.ย. 04, 2008 9:07 am

โพสต์โดย dD เมื่อ จันทร์ พ.ย. 10, 2008 1:18 pm

test ก่อนครับ ว่า bat file ที่สั่งให้ serial port ทำงาน น่ะ มัน รันหรือเปล่า

ดูคำสั่งแล้วพิมพ์ตามครับ หรือพิมพ์ ชื่อ batch file นั้นเพื่อสั่งรัน

แล้ว ลองเทสต์การทำงานว่า มันส่งข้อมูลออกไหม

อยู่ที่ c:\
dir *.* > lpt2

เป็นการส่งข้อมูลออกไปยัง lpt2 จะได้ทราบว่า มันทำงานไหม

ถ้าทำงาน ก็ไปเชคว่า config ของ user ได้สั่ง ให้พิมพ์ใบสั่งยาออก lpt2 ไหม
dD
 
โพสต์: 47
ลงทะเบียนเมื่อ: ศุกร์ ต.ค. 31, 2008 9:11 am

ขอละเอียดหน่อยอะคับ

โพสต์โดย Nongyai เมื่อ จันทร์ พ.ย. 10, 2008 1:46 pm

ถ้ารันไม่ได้ผลเป็นงัยอะคับ.............แล้วถ้า bat file มันใช้ได้จะแสดงอย่างไรอะคับ.....
ถ้าผลคือมันไม่ Run จะแก้ไงอะคับ.......ขอบคุณ..คับ
Nongyai
 
โพสต์: 5
ลงทะเบียนเมื่อ: อังคาร พ.ย. 04, 2008 9:07 am

โพสต์โดย dD เมื่อ จันทร์ พ.ย. 10, 2008 2:19 pm

เห็น แบทไฟล์ ที่รันไหมครับ น่าจะใช้ชื่อ p.bat อยู่ใน f:\serial

สั่งรัน ก็ พิมพ์ บน a:\ or c:\ ว่า p.bat แล้ว Enter

สังเกต หน้าจอครับ จะบอกว่า mode lpt2=com1
mode com1:9600,n8,1,p

ถ้ามันทำงานได้ มันจะไม่ฟ้อง อะไรออกมา แล้ว พริ๊นเตอร์ที่ต่อ ซีเรียลพอร์ต จะขยับ ๆๆ (ดังตึ๊ก ๆ)

ถ้าไม่ได้ ก็ต้องเชค ว่า พอร์ตเสียไหม (อันนี้ผมเดาว่า รันบนตัวเก่า)

ถ้าเป็นตัวใหม่ ก็ต้องไปเชคว่า เปิดพอร์ต com1 หรือยัง
dD
 
โพสต์: 47
ลงทะเบียนเมื่อ: ศุกร์ ต.ค. 31, 2008 9:11 am

ขอบคุณคับ....

โพสต์โดย Nongyai เมื่อ จันทร์ พ.ย. 10, 2008 2:51 pm

ยังไม่ได้อะคับ....มันฟ้อง
c:\mode lpt2=com1
Incorrect DOS version

port serial ใน bios ก็เปิดเป็น Auto หมดแล้ว ตอนนี้ผมใช้ V.8 อยู่อะคับ....

...รบกวนถามผ่านทาง M ได้เปล่าคับ... ardhan_007@hotmail.com...(^-^)
Nongyai
 
โพสต์: 5
ลงทะเบียนเมื่อ: อังคาร พ.ย. 04, 2008 9:07 am

โพสต์โดย dD เมื่อ อังคาร พ.ย. 11, 2008 8:34 am

incorrect dos version น่าจะเกิดจากคุณไปรันบน os ที่ไม่ใช่ dos น่ะครับ

ตัวนี้ใช้ได้เฉพาะ Dos6 ฉะนั้นเครื่องที่จะใช้ 2 printer จะต้องเป็นเครื่องที่รันบน rom boot หรือ boot ด้วย dos6 ครับ
dD
 
โพสต์: 47
ลงทะเบียนเมื่อ: ศุกร์ ต.ค. 31, 2008 9:11 am

โพสต์โดย mit เมื่อ อังคาร พ.ย. 11, 2008 9:44 am

mode เป็นคำสั่งภายนอกครับ ก็คือโปรแกรมหนึ่งนั่นเอง ตอ้งใช้งานให้ตรง version ครับ ที่ทำไว้ให้บน server เป็นของ dos6.22 ถ้าจะใช้บน window ก็สามารถทำได้โดยกำหนด PATH ให้เต็มๆ เช่นบน winXP อยู่ที่ c:\windows\system32\mode.com ครับ
mit
 
โพสต์: 314
ลงทะเบียนเมื่อ: จันทร์ ต.ค. 27, 2008 11:47 pm

โพสต์โดย dD เมื่อ อังคาร พ.ย. 11, 2008 11:36 am

หมอสุมิตร มาตอบเองแล้ว น่าจะถูก

ผมไม่เคย รัน สองพอร์ต บน os ตัวอื่นสักที มันยุ่งไปหน่อย
dD
 
โพสต์: 47
ลงทะเบียนเมื่อ: ศุกร์ ต.ค. 31, 2008 9:11 am


ย้อนกลับไปยัง ถาม-ตอบ ปัญหาต่างๆ เกี่ยวกับโปรแกรม MIT-NET

ผู้ใช้งานขณะนี้

กำลังดูบอร์ดนี้: ไม่มีสมาชิกใหม่ และ บุคคลทั่วไป 36 ท่าน